Anitah Fabiola back from France, says it was not photoshop

Beauty queen and TV host, Anitah Fabiola real names Anitah Kyalimpa is back from France where she had gone for the Cannes Film Festival.

Fabie who had a good time in France and let her fans know all about it on her Instagram is back and happy to be in Uganda.

Fabiola who is looking fresh from France has this to say.

‘I was in Cannes which is South of France for a whole two weeks. Every night was a different screening for a movie. I was at 4 different carpets and it was all great. Haters say it was Photoshop but it wasn’t. I had an amazing time there. The thing is that cameras and phones are not allowed on the carpet. This is the most organised red carpet event in the whole world. I had a lot of fan.’

Anitah Fabiola is now back on NBS Katch Up for her fans who have been missing her.
